Is Sherwood Isle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is extremely safe. Sherwood Isle in Lakeland, FL has a safety grade of A+. The overall crime index is 8, which is 92% below the national average of 100.
Compared to the Lakeland average (crime index 135), Sherwood Isle is 127%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Lakeland as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, rape is the most elevated concern (index: 124, 24%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 11).
